Clerkship in Primary Care in General Pediatrics
Instructors
- Jay S. Epstein, M.D. c
- Paul S. Simons, M.D. c
The Clerkship in Primary Care in General Pediatrics is designed to provide
the student with first-hand experience in general pediatric practice in a
model ambulatory care setting at the Forest Park Pediatrics office on the
medical campus. The major component of the clerkship is direct patient
care under the supervision of the senior physicians who are members of the
group.
Students will join individual pediatricians as colleagues caring for
pediatric patients under supervision. The broad spectrum of general
ambulatory pediatrics including behavioral pediatrics, developmental
pediatrics, preventive medicine and acute care aspects of pediatric
practice will be emphasized. The objective of this elective is to provide
the student with the actual experience of serving as a general pediatrician
providing comprehensive health services to the families of a typical
broadly based population receiving care through different insurance
systems. Valid start weeks for 4-week blocks are: Weeks, 1, 5, 9, 13, 17,
21, 25, 29, 33, 37 and 41.
